11. Self diagnosis
11.1 Self-diagnosis status read
This command is used in order to read the Self-diagnosis status.
1) The controller requests the monitor to read Self-diagnosis status.
Header
SOH-'0'-'A'-'0'-'A'-'0'-'4'
Header
SOH (01h): Start of Header
'0' (30h): Reserved
'A' (41h): Monitor ID
LCD3210 must be ASCII 'A' (41h).
'0' (30h): Message sender is the controller
'A' (41h): Message type is "Command"
'0'-'4'(30h, 34h): Message length.
Message
STX (02h): Start of Message
'B'-'1' (42h, 31h): Self-diagnosis command
ETX (03h): End of Message
Check code
BCC: Block Check Code
Refer to the section 4.5 "Check code" for a BCC calculation.
Delimiter
CR (0Dh): End of packet
2) The monitor replies a result of the self-diagnosis.
Header
SOH-'0'-'0'-'A'-'B'-N-N
Header
SOH (01h): Start Of Header
'0' (30h): Reserved
'0' (30h): Message receiver is the controller
'A' (41h): Monitor ID
LCD3210 must be ASCII 'A' (41h).
'B' (42h): Message type is "Command reply "
N-N: Message length.
Note.) The maximum data length that can be written to the monitor at a time is 32bytes.
Ex.) The byte data 20h is encoded as ASCII characters '2' and '0' (34h and 30h).
Message
STX (02h): Start of Message
'A'-'1' (41h, 31h): Application Test Report reply command
ST: Result of self-tests
00:Normal
70:Analog 3.3V abnormality
71:Analog 12V abnormality
72:Analog 5V abnormality
73:Audio amplifier +12V abnormality
78:Panel 12V abnormality
80:Cooling fan-1 abnormality
81:Cooling fan-2 abnormality
The byte data 70 is encoded as ASCII characters '7' and '0' (37h and 30h).
